What is a computer contract?

Computer contracts are legally binding agreements related to the use, development, sale, or maintenance of computer hardware, software, or IT services. These contracts may cover topics like licensing, support, consulting, or outsourcing of computer-related tasks. They help define the responsibilities, rights, and expectations of the parties involved, ensuring clarity and reducing the risk of disputes. Well-drafted computer contracts are essential in the technology sector to protect intellectual property, manage risks, and outline service levels.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als working on computer contract assignments, and how can they be managed?

Professionals working on computer contract assignments often face challenges such as rapidly adapting to new client environments, managing fluctuating workloads, and maintaining a steady pipeline of projects. Effective communication with clients and clear documentation of project requirements are key to minimizing misunderstandings. Additionally, staying current with industry trends and continually updating technical skills can help contractors remain competitive and secure future assignments. Networking and leveraging professional platforms can also aid in finding new opportunities and building a reputation for reliability.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a computer contractor,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Computer Contractor, you typically need expertise in computer systems, software development or IT support, along with a relevant degree or certifications such as CompTIA, Microsoft, or Cisco. Familiarity with project management tools, cloud platforms, and specialized software (e.g., AWS, Jira, or Git) is often required. Strong client communication, adaptability, and self-management skills help you stand out in this independent role. These skills ensure you can deliver high-quality technical solutions while managing client expectations and project timelines effectively.

Computer Aided Dispatch (CAD) AdministratorOverview

We are seeking an experienced Computer Aided Dispatch (CAD) Administrator to support the implementation, configuration, maintenance, and optimization of public safety technology solutions. This role works closely with law enforcement, fire, and EMS organizations to deploy and support CAD, RMS, and Mobile platforms that are critical to emergency response operations.

Required Qualifications
  • 5+ years of experience working within or consulting for Public Safety organizations
  • Proven experience implementing, configuring, administering, or supporting CAD, RMS, and/or Mobile solutions
  • Strong subject matter expertise in public safety systems and workflows
  • Intermediate knowledge of IT infrastructure, including databases, networking, and virtualization
  • Intermediate to advanced pro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int), Microsoft Project, and SharePoint
  • Ability to obtain CJIS certification and successfully pass required background checks
Preferred Qualifications
  • Experience with Geographic Information Systems (GIS)
  • Knowledge of cloud technologies and cloud-based environments
  • Experience with CentralSquare CAD products
Key Responsibilities
  • Install, configure, test, troubleshoot, and maintain public safety software applications
  • Support CAD, RMS, and Mobile solutions for emergency response organizations
  • Administer application environments, including production, test, and training systems
  • Configure system settings and business rules to meet operational requirements
  • Perform user administration, security management, and application maintenance
  • Maintain and update application documentation and technical procedures
  • Provide end-user support, training, and consultation
  • Collaborate across teams to manage application integrations and dependencies
  • Apply software updates, patches, and enhancements
  • Ensure system performance, reliability, security, and compliance with applicable standards
  • Participate in an on-call rotation supporting mission-critical applications
